    Indiana Code
    Chapter 5. Jurisdiction
    31-21-5-12. Continuous Duty to Inform

    Sec. 12. Each party has a continuing duty to inform the court of a proceeding in Indiana or any other state that may affect the current proceeding.
    As added by P.L.138-2007, SEC.45.
